Question: 
Is it permissible for the one who says directly after the Salaam ( of concluding the prayer), he seeks from those praying to mention Al Faatiha for cure? 
Imam Muqbil Ibn Haadee Al Waadiee:
No, this Is an innovation, As Sanaanee said in Subulis Salaam after he mentioned the supplications which have been reported after the prayer, such as 
اللهم اعني على ذكرك و شكرك و حسن عبادتك, 
And such as the reading of Ayatul Kursi, At Tasbeeh (saying Subhanallah) At Takbeer (saying Allahu Akbar) At Tahleel (saying La ilaaha Illallah).
He says: And as for the statement: Al Faatiha due to such and such intention, then it is an innovation, it hasn’t been affirmed from the prophet Sallallahu alaihi wassallam.
و الله المستعان.
End. 
Translator’s Note :Imam As Sanaani statement can be found in Subulus Salaam in the explanation of the Hadeeth of Abu Huraira number 313 
Volume 1 page 303 print Ihya At Turaath.
